Promote dev to uat: GRO-1791 Book Now CTA #13

Merged
The Dogfather merged 3 commits from dev into uat 2026-05-26 12:17:10 +00:00

3 Commits

Author SHA1 Message Date
The Dogfather 3e9d227388 Merge pull request 'feat(GRO-1791): landing page Book Now CTA' (#12) from feature/gro-1165a-book-now-cta into dev
Merge PR #12: feat(GRO-1791): landing page Book Now CTA

CTO approved after QA pass. Adds Book an Appointment CTA to hero, footer nav, and getting-started page.
2026-05-26 12:15:51 +00:00
Flea Flicker f67470581e docs(GRO-1791): add TC-3.1–TC-3.5 to UAT_PLAYBOOK for self-booking CTA
Added test cases covering:
- Hero "Book an Appointment" button visibility and order
- All 4 hero CTA buttons present
- Mobile responsiveness at 375px width
- Footer "Book Now" link navigation
- Getting-started page booking CTA

Also fixed repo URL from github.com/site to git.farh.net/groombook/groombook.dev.

cc @cpfarhood

Co-Authored-By: Paperclip <noreply@paperclip.ing>
2026-05-26 11:50:09 +00:00
Flea Flicker c1a6539af3 feat(GRO-1791): add Book Now CTA to landing page hero and navigation
- Add "Book an Appointment" as first CTA button in hero section, linking
  to https://groombook.dev/admin/book
- Add "Book Now" to footer navigation links
- Add "Book an Appointment" quick-link to getting-started page
- Preserve all existing CTAs (Try Demo, Get Started, View on GitHub)

cc @cpfarhood

Co-Authored-By: Paperclip <noreply@paperclip.ing>
2026-05-26 11:48:41 +00:00